From 4f969102916872db85296709d700ff387fe3a0c2 Mon Sep 17 00:00:00 2001 From: Surpriseplus <845948745@qq.com> Date: 星期三, 21 十二月 2022 19:59:52 +0800 Subject: [PATCH] 专题图,数据上传 --- src/views/datamanage/dataLoader.vue | 41 ++++++++++++++++++++++++----------------- 1 files changed, 24 insertions(+), 17 deletions(-) diff --git a/src/views/datamanage/dataLoader.vue b/src/views/datamanage/dataLoader.vue index 8538644..8384dfa 100644 --- a/src/views/datamanage/dataLoader.vue +++ b/src/views/datamanage/dataLoader.vue @@ -42,15 +42,22 @@ </el-select> </el-form-item> - <el-form-item> - <input id="uploadfile" @change= "handleFileChange" type="file" name="file" multiple="multiple" accept=".xls,.xlsx,.mdb,.shp.zip,.gdb.zip" style="display: none"></input> - <!-- <el-button icon="el-icon-document-add" @click="fileSelect" class="primary">{{ - $t('common.file') - }}</el-button> --> - <el-input v-model="formInline.fileName" disabled> - <template slot="append"> - <el-button v-if="formInline.fileName == '鏈�夋嫨鏂囦欢'" + <el-form-item> + <el-input + type="textarea" + v-model="formInline.fileName" + + class="nm-skin-pretty" + show-word-limit + :rows="2" resize='none' + style="width: 650px;" + ></el-input> + </el-form-item> + <el-form-item> + <input id="uploadfile" @change= "handleFileChange" type="file" name="file" multiple="multiple" accept=".xls,.xlsx,.mdb,.shp.zip,.gdb.zip" style="display: none"></input> + + <el-button v-if="formInline.fileName == '鏈�夋嫨鏂囦欢'" type="info" @click="fileSelect"> 閫夋嫨鏂囦欢 @@ -62,14 +69,9 @@ > 閲嶇疆 </el-button> - </template> - </el-input> - - - </el-form-item> <br /> - <el-form-item :label="$t('dataManage.dataUpObj.describe')"> + <el-form-item > <el-input type="textarea" v-model="formInline.descr" @@ -936,10 +938,15 @@ $("#uploadfile").click(); }, handleFileChange(event) { + var std =[]; + var len = event.currentTarget.files.length; + for(var i = 0;i<len;i++){ +var f = event.currentTarget.files[i]; +std.push(f.name) + } - // var fs = document.getElementById("uploadfile"); - var f = event.currentTarget.files[0] - this.formInline.fileName = f.name; + this.formInline.fileName =std.toString() ; + }, clearFileSelect(){ -- Gitblit v1.9.3